Papa Haydn serves excellent food and dessert, and the environment of the restaurant is fun and sophisticated. The neighborhood (NW 23rd Ave) is fun, and I think adds to the appeal of the restaurant.
The food is delicious and creative, and you have plenty of options. The desserts, though, are a major draw. The cakes, the panna cotta, anything with chocolate -- Papa Haydn knows their desserts and offers a wide selection.
Expect a bit of a wait on weekends, but the wait is worth it (and save room for dessert!).

I bought my wedding dress from Charlotte's. It's a wonderful experience to try on dresses there--they are very nice, and have beautiful "trying-on" rooms. They don't accept returns, which is normal, but the only con was that they were the ones who measured me, and then picked the size of dress to order accordingly. The dress was a bit tight when it came (no, I hadn't gained weight!), and they wouldn't exchange it. Make sure they order on the bigger rather than smaller side.

This grooming/boarding shop is ideal in nature. Easy check in and check out. You're welcomed to tour the facilities to ensure your pet is well cared for during it's visits.
The shop is always clean (amazing feat in and of itself) and the staff are always friendly.
Calling ahead is advisable as they are busy and have Saturday hours.
Holidays fill up fast so call in advance.
Located right next door to Laurelhurst Vet Clinic, Townhouse is in touch with the Clinic and will facilitate any needed visits to and from if needed.
Very customer service oriented.

I simply love this place. I could wander around for days at a time. This place is a book lover's dream. The building takes up a full city block and has several floors. There are books for just about every taste. Plus they buy books and seem to give a fair deal for them.
Here is a place with books for every taste and every budget. Go see for yourself.
